Output 253e3c7503af6b0d1ac47d6134996db53eafd3b06081f64b19f6d0d0b6fc8c6a:6

value
40201494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7f970dc3a7dfafb32c33da8d925abc4b088bddc OP_EQUAL
address
MPDKtvMTVq197QV3rcGEnUUtZrryKeEkqb
transaction
253e3c7503af6b0d1ac47d6134996db53eafd3b06081f64b19f6d0d0b6fc8c6a
spent
true